Scope and Content Jet and Amber (Illustration nos. as in Excavation Report) BD56/1/24/1 Jet Illus 57.1 Bead. Elaborately decorated: a convex-sided cone with pentagonal ribs. Central cylindrical perforation. BD56/1/24/5 Jet Illus 57.5 Bead fragment: half a hexagonal bead with openwork decoration. Central perforation. BD56/1/24/2 Jet Illus 57.2 Bead. Elongated, triangular-sectioned. Longitudinal cylindrical perforation BD56/1/24/3 Jet Illus 57.3 Modified rectangular bead. BD56/1/24/6 Amber Illus 57.6 Spherical amber bead with a central perforation.
